Output 785668bf1bc84f9684f05ee334a1d26d1a6d4de954bf324ca2a435d0fbbe3670:9

value
4874800
script pubkey
OP_0 OP_PUSHBYTES_20 df543bfb6918b981e0f9662c44de25737eee99e8
address
bc1qma2rh7mfrzucrc8evckyfh39wdlwax0g39g6vg
transaction
785668bf1bc84f9684f05ee334a1d26d1a6d4de954bf324ca2a435d0fbbe3670
confirmations
202944
spent
true